The holiday season brings the irresistible lure of discounts. From special holiday sales to post-Christmas markdowns, retailers promise major savings. But when it comes to Christmas shopping, are these "bargain bonanzas" truly a blessing, or do they risk bursting your budget?
The key to navigating the holiday
shopping season lies in smart deal strategies. While waiting for last-minute
Christmas discounts may help you save a few bucks, it can also lead to stress,
limited stock, and missed opportunities. Let’s explore how you can take
advantage of holiday deals across Europe and the Western world without falling
victim to common shopping traps.
Trap 1: The "Too Good to Pass Up"
Discount
Have you ever seen a 50% off sign
and felt the urge to grab it, even if the item wasn’t on your shopping list?
Retailers love to play on FOMO (fear of missing out). Keep in mind that a
discount only counts as a deal if it aligns with your actual needs. Before
purchasing, ask yourself:
- **Does this fit my budget and my gift list? **
- **Would I buy this item at full price? **
- **Have I found a similar, more affordable alternative? **
By staying mindful and avoiding
impulse buys, you’ll save money and avoid clutter under the tree.
Trap 2: The "Limited Availability" FOMO
Did you find the perfect present
but are worried it might sell out before you can get it? Retailers often use
scarcity to push shoppers into quick decisions. Here’s how to stay calm and
make the best choice:
- **Compare prices online and in other stores. **
- **Check stock availability at nearby locations or online. **
- **Consider alternatives. ** If the item is truly
one-of-a-kind, it might be worth buying now. However, if you have other viable
options, it may be better to wait for a better deal.
Patience is a key tool for
successful shopping. Don’t let FOMO cloud your judgment — a missed deal today
could lead to a better one tomorrow.
Bonus Tip: Plan Ahead for Stress-Free Holiday
Shopping
- **Make a Christmas shopping list early. **
Identify your gift priorities to avoid unnecessary purchases when deals heat
up.
- **Set and stick to a budget. ** Don’t let the
"sale fever" make you overspend.
- **Use online tools and price comparison websites. **
These tools can help you track discounts and ensure you’re getting the best
possible deal.
By incorporating these
strategies, you can turn chaotic Christmas shopping into a calculated and
enjoyable experience. Celebrate the season with meaningful gifts, lasting
memories, and a budget that sings carols instead of ringing alarms.
